Nieuws Uit De Ruimtevaart – Week 2022/18–598

Drie lanceringen en 86 nieuwe satellieten. Drie astronauten keren terug van het ruimtestation, China maakt zich klaar voor een volgend hoofdstuk van hun ruimtestation. En verder aftellen naar de lancering van Starliner OFT-2 en een nieuwe WDR-poging voor het SLS.

Maar deze NUDR heeft ook een hele verzameling artikels uit de voorbije maand over (allerlei) satellietconstellaties, satellite servicing (zoals het bijtanken van satellieten) maar ook over het bouwen ervan in de ruimte, over ruimteafval en duurzame ruimtevaart. En het militaire in de ruimtevaart ontbreekt dezer dagen niet.

Dat en nog veel meer in het Nieuws Uit De Ruimtevaart van deze week.
 

Bij de foto: Capsule Endurance werd gebruikt voor de vlucht van Crew 3. Die vlucht kwam op 6 mei na 177 dagen aan zijn einde. Aan boord bevonden zich Raja Chari, Kayla Barron, Tom Marshburn en ESA astronaut Matthias Maurer. Foto: NASA/Aubrey Gemignani.
